One common misconception among small business owners and creators is this:
“If I post TikToks, Reels, or Shorts with SEO keywords, my website will rank on Google’s first page immediately.”
That’s not how Google works.
Social media videos — including TikToks, Instagram Reels, YouTube Shorts, and LinkedIn videos — do not directly push your website to page one overnight, even if your captions are keyword-rich.
However, when used strategically, they act as a powerful SEO “spark” that accelerates visibility, authority, and long-term rankings.
How the Indirect SEO Formula Actually Works
1. Boosted Visibility → Traffic Signals
High-performing social videos expose your brand to new audiences.
When those viewers:
- click through to your website
- search your brand name later
- engage with your content
Google receives positive engagement signals, which indicate relevance and credibility.
👉 More qualified traffic = stronger SEO signals over time.
2. Backlink Creation (The Hidden SEO Multiplier)
When a video performs well socially:
- Bloggers
- Journalists
- Content creators
- Educators
are more likely to discover, trust, and reference your content.
This leads to earned backlinks, which remain one of Google’s strongest ranking factors.
Viral or insightful social videos increase the probability of backlinks — not by force, but by visibility.
3. Increased Dwell Time Through Embedded Videos
When you embed videos on your website:
- Visitors stay longer
- Bounce rates decrease
- Pages feel more useful and engaging
This improves dwell time, a behavioural metric Google associates with content quality.
For Lepakcreator, this is critical:
video + written explanation = stronger SEO than either alone.
4. Indexed Social Content (This Is New — and Important)
Google increasingly indexes social content itself, including:
- YouTube videos
- Instagram Reels
- LinkedIn posts
- Video carousels and “Perspectives” results
This means:
- Your video can appear directly in Google search
- Even if your website doesn’t rank yet
- Especially for long-tail and exploratory queries
This is where search intent + captions + subtitles become essential.
Key Components That Make Social Video SEO-Effective
To turn social videos into long-term SEO assets, all of the following must work together:
Keyword-Rich Captions (Social SEO/AEO)
Captions should:
- Reflect real search queries
- Use natural language (not keyword stuffing)
- Match what users would type into Google
Example:
❌ “CNY facial vibes ✨”
✅ “First-time CNY facial guide for sensitive skin in Singapore”
Closed Captions / Subtitles (Non-Negotiable)
Subtitles:
- Provide crawlable text for search engines
- Improve accessibility
- Are especially powerful on YouTube (owned by Google)
Without captions, your video is largely invisible to search engines.
Strategic, Targeted Hashtags
Hashtags should:
- Support discoverability
- Reinforce topic relevance
- Be niche-specific, not generic
Example:
#videoseosingapore
#contentmarketingforsmes
Not:
#fyp #viral #trending

Q: Does posting more content always improve marketing results?
A: Not necessarily. More posts, reels, captions, or blogs can create activity—but not always real progress. Without strategy, consistency, and intent alignment, it often leads to noise instead of growth. Effective marketing focuses on the right content mix, not just higher volume.
Q: What does credibility on social media mean?
A: Social media credibility refers to how your audience perceives your account as trustworthy, consistent, and knowledgeable based on your strategised content, brand tone, and consistent interactions over time.
For anyone starting a new social media or online account, credibility is not something you claim — it is something you intentionally build. This is especially important because users today are highly cautious and will quickly judge whether an account feels like a genuine personal brand, a business, or something untrustworthy.
Ultimately, what makes you different is not just what you sell or post — it is how you build perception over time. Credibility comes from repeated, consistent actions that help people feel, “This account is real, helpful, and worth following,” instead of feeling like it exists only to sell something.
